As soon as your teeth are healthy and also prepared to go, we require to prep your teeth. To prep your teeth for porcelain veneers, we must first eliminate a slim layer of your enamel to make room for the veneers. Although this may seem hazardous to your teeth, it's not due to the fact that we're bonding veneers over your teeth. Your teeth will certainly have a lot more protection than before and not experience discoloring like with natural teeth. We then make use of a special bonding concrete to bond the veneer to your teeth. The bonding product is entirely secure as well as does not damage your teeth. This simple procedure offers you with gorgeous results that supply your teeth with security and also stop stains.

What happens to veneers over time?
Porcelain Veneers Are Permanent.
Porcelain veneers are permanent because, during the veneer procedure, some of the structure of the teeth is changed before the veneers are applied. Typically, this involves the removal of tooth enamel.
While veneers do not make it most likely that you'll struggle with dental caries, they do make it more vital than ever that you maintain a good oral hygiene regimen. The teeth under your veneers can still gather plaque and also tartar, which indicates they may eventually create tiny openings in them. If cavities develop on these teeth, they could not have the ability to support your veneers after your dentist deals with the degeneration. Do porcelain veneers chip easily?
The dental Lab made bad quality porcelain veneers.
The veneers can look too opaque, too monochromatic, too bulky or most importantly the can be too weak to withstand everyday chewing. This can cause the veneers to chip, crack or debond.
